Lady Gaga let down her poker face.

The "Paparazzi" songstress known for her blonde locks, oversized sunglasses and outrageous, often face-obscuring ensembles finally revealed her face during an apperance on a German chat show "Wetten Dass...?" yesterday, British newspaper The Daily Mail reported

The smoky-eyed songbird appeared somewhat mainstream on the show Saturday night when she waltzed onto the stage wearing an all black strapless ensemble with material that jutted out of her hips perpendicularly and matching black PVC boots.

The 23-year-old singer was showing so much of her own skin that she was able to discuss the tattoos on her arm with the host, including one tattoo of a poem by German writer Rainer Maria Rilke, the paper reported.

Eccentric style choices have come to be expected from the singer, whose fashion selections have included face-obscuring lace headpieces, a leather dress encircled with oversized gold crystals and a piece made entirely out of Kermit the Frog stuffed animals.

The singer's design team, Haus of Gaga, is primarily responsible for her outfits.

"They're my best friends," she told MTV. "I'm not really sure what the world thinks ... but I do hear things like, 'Who is the Haus of Gaga? and 'Are you putting out a fashion line?' And no one gets it. It's not a commodity. It's not something that's meant to be sold."
